Oh hey, it's the video for Sara Bareilles ' very good single "Brave" ! The track — her first taken from her upcoming LP The Blessed Unrest — has a big singalong hook and an inspirational be-your-best-self message, so fittingly, the accompanying clip is nice and sunny: "Normal people" dance like total goons in various locales (a gym, a shopping mall, a bus stop, a library). The bravest thing about the video, though, is that Bareilles is wearing a black-and-white polka dot blouse on top of black-and-white pants that are covered in cursive writing. Truly courageous. Sara Bareilles fans, prepare for your kaleidoscope hearts to skip a beat or two, as the queen of radio-friendly piano pop has returned with brand new single "Brave." The song was co-penned by fun. 's Jack Antanoff , and as such, doesn't sound dissimilar from the Grammy-winning band's anthem-like hits (or, for that matter, frontman Nate Ruess ' duet with Pink , "Just Give Me A Reason" ). Singer-songwriter Jon McLaughlin will hit the road this fall for his headlining So Solo Tour . The tour kicks off on October 6, 2012 in Ames, IA and wraps on October 28th in Madison, WI. Jon McLaughlin's new album Promising Promises (Razor & Tie) was released earlier this year and features the single, "Summer Is Over," with Sara Bareilles - watch the video below, here on Band Weblogs . Greg Laswell’s pop-driven, poignant songwriting is such that he has earned play in several TV shows and movies (Grey's Anatomy , True Blood , My Sister's Keeper , Dollhouse ). Now with his fifth full-length record, Landline , he continues his tradition of writing stellar tunes that embody great songwriting- they’re catchy, but not too much so, they have lyrical depth, skilled yet simple arrangements, and abound with beautiful melodies. Laswell's style embodies somewhat of a combination between the melancholia of Stephin Merritt (the Magnetic Fields), or perhaps the pop sensibility of David Gray. [...]

John Mayer can pop a bottle over the fact that the singer-songwriter's Born And Raised has become his third chart-topping LP. Mayer's first album in three years debuts atop the Billboard Top 200 on the strength of 219,000 copies sold, and sends last week's #1, Adam Lambert 's Trespassing (22,000), tumbling down to #11.
